What to Do If You Receive a Call from 04 3334 3446
If 04 3334 3446 calls you:
- Do not: Return the call, provide card details, or verify account information over the phone
- Do not: Follow any links or instructions mentioned in the message
- Do: Let unknown calls go to voicemail
- Do: Hang up immediately if you answer
- Do: Contact your bank directly using the number on the back of your card or their official website if you're concerned about account activity
- Do: Block 0433343446 on your phone to prevent future calls
What to Do If You Receive an SMS from 04 3334 3446
If 04 3334 3446 sends you a text message:
- Do not: Click any links in the message
- Do not: Reply or engage with the sender
- Do: Delete the message immediately
- Do: Report the SMS as spam to your provider by forwarding to 0429 999 888
- Do: Block the number 0433343446
How to Report 04 3334 3446
If you receive suspicious contact from 04 3334 3446 or 0433343446:
- Report to the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) at acma.gov.au
- Lodge a report with Scamwatch at scamwatch.gov.au
- If card fraud is involved, report to ReportCyber at cyber.gov.au
- Contact your bank or payment card issuer directly
